Mark Foy is summoned back to Zoron by Princess Zayla, bored at being left alone as her brother goes off adventuring. She doesn’t realize they are in for a frightening adventure set off by the reappearance of Blaylock, the evil uncle, and Fentar, the evil genius sidekick. Will Prince Zincor’s return be enough to rescue them, or will he, too, fall under Blaylock’s control?

    Chapter One

    Princess Zayla, ten-year-old twin sister of Prince Zincor, ruler of Zoron, sat at her bedroom window in the palace and stared impatiently into space. She had nothing to do until the time came for her to use the Tappa Ray. Before her brother left, she insisted that he and Bazel, the ancient, trusted councilor of her late father, teach her how to use it. It caused a big argument, but she won. Her brother had been gone for three days, and she felt bored. She wouldn’t be for much longer, though, she hoped. Soon, she would give the third signal to Earth, and Mark Foy would be with her—if he’d been paying attention. According to the agreement they’d made, Mark would look for the quick, green burst of the Tappa Ray signal every night at the moment of moonrise, and on the third night of signaling, the Tappa Ray would pluck him from his bedroom window. Instantly, in a green fog with the sound of a thousand bees buzzing in his ear, he’d be transported into the dimension between Earth and its moon and be plopped down on the cold stone floor of the Tappa Ray laboratory.

    Zayla hoped with all her heart that Mark would be ready and willing to make the trip—she looked at the clock on her bedroom wall—in two hours. Zincor went off adventuring, and she had to stay at home, but being a princess, she simply could not go out into the streets to play like the other children of Zoron. Oh, no, what a terrible thing that would be. Zayla frowned, made a fist, smacked the windowsill, and took another glance at the clock.
